Make sure that the roofing company you hire has the required appropriate business permits for your local area
If you are possibly not aware of the requirements of the business licenses for contractors in your local area, make sure that you contact the licensing authorities for confirmation. You may also go ahead and visit the website of the licensing of the contractors. Click here to read more about this.

If you want to know whether the roofing contractors company is legitimate, you can ask them to give you their tax identification number, the address of their business, the business website or their email address as well as their office contact number.

They should also provide you with a proof of their insurance that should include the employer's compensation and liability coverage
You state may not be requiring the contractors to have the insurance, but you may want to hire a person with insurance so that you can protect yourself from lawsuits if the workers of the contractors get injured while working on your property. Confirm that the insurance covers the whole duration at which the roofing task is going to take.

Request the roofing company for a record of references and photos of their past works as well as giving you the contacts of their past clients to know if they were gratified with the job done on their roof.
